Tue Mar 10 05:30:00 UTC 2026: ### Headline: Speaker Dismisses Allegations Against Minister Ganesh Kumar as a Family Matter

The Story:

Kerala Assembly Speaker A.N. Shamseer has dismissed recent allegations against Minister K.B. Ganesh Kumar as a family issue resolved by the parties involved. Speaking in Kozhikode on March 10, 2026, Shamseer stated that the media had highlighted a family problem, which, according to media reports, has now been resolved by the family themselves. He expressed his belief that family disputes should not be politicized, especially with upcoming election announcements imminent within a few days. He suggested that the public should decide the matter in the upcoming elections.
